Banco Santander Sa reports 14.2% CAPEX decline and 3.1% Revenue decline

25 Jan 2017 • About Banco Santander Sa ($BNC) • By InTwits

Banco Santander Sa reported 2016 financial results today. Overall the company's long term financial model is characterised by the following facts:
  • Banco Santander Sa is a company in decline: 2016 revenue growth was -3.1%, 5 years revenue CAGR was -2.6%
  • Banco Santander Sa has medium CAPEX intensity: 5 year average CAPEX/Revenue was 6.7%. At the same time it's a lot of higher than industry average of 3.7%.
  • CAPEX is quite volatile: 6,572 in 2016, 7,664 in 2015, 6,695 in 2014, 1,877 in 2013, 2,161 in 2012
  • The company has potentially unprofitable business model: ROIC is at 2.0%

Revenue and profitability


Banco Santander Sa's Revenue decreased on 3.1% in 2016.

Net Income marign increased slightly on 0.58 pp from 8.0% to 8.5% in 2016.

Capital expenditures (CAPEX) and working capital investments


In 2016 Banco Santander Sa had CAPEX/Revenue of 9.1%. Banco Santander Sa showed CAPEX/Revenue growth of 6.5 pp from 2.6% in 2013 to 9.1% in 2016. It's average CAPEX/Revenue for the last three years was 9.4%.

Return on investment


The company operates at low ROIC (1.97%) and ROE (6.93%). ROIC showed almost no change in 2016. ROE showed almost no change in 2016.

Leverage (Debt)


Debt decreased on 5.8% in 2016 while cash decreased slightly on 1.7% in 2016.
